Genes provide For a cell to assemble molecules that express traits such as eye color of seed shape

Physics
1 answer:
Shalnov [3]3 years ago
5 0
<h3><u>Answer;</u></h3>

Directions

Genes provide <u>directions</u> for a cell to assemble molecules that express traits such as eye color of seed shape.

<h3><u>Explanation;</u></h3>
  • <em><u>A gene is a segment of DNA on a chromosome that codes for a specific trait. It is the set of information that controls a given trait.</u></em>
  • Each gene occupies a specific position on a chromosome. Genes are responsible for characteristics inherited by an individual from the parents,because genes provide instructions for making proteins, and proteins determine the structure and function of each cell in the body.

What is the distance to a star whose parallex is 0.1 sec?
Arte-miy333 [17]

Answer:

30.86\times 10^{13} km

Explanation:

Given the parallex of the star is 0.1 sec.

The distance is inversely related with the parallex of the star. Mathematically,

d=\frac{1}{P}

Here, d is the distance to a star which is measured in parsecs, and P is the parallex which is measured in arc seconds.

Now,

d=\frac{1}{0.1}\\d=10 parsec

And also know that,

1 parsec=3.086\times 10^{13} km

Therefore the distance of the star  is 30.86\times 10^{13} km away.

A motorcycle has a mass of 250kg. It goes around a 13.7 m radius turn at 96.5 km/hr. What is the centripetal force?
topjm [15]

Answer: c) 1.31 × 10⁴N

Explanation:

Centripetal force is a force that causes a body to move in a circular path. The body possesses a centripetal acceleration.

According to newtons first law

Force = mass (m) ×acceleration (a)

Acceleration of a body moving in a circular path = v²/r where;

v is the velocity and r is the radius

Force = MV²/r

Given m = 250kg v = 96.5km/hr r = 13.7m

We need to convert 96.5km/hr to m/s

= 96.5km ×1000/1hr × 3600

= 96,500/3,600

v = 26.8m/s

Force = 250 × 26.8²/13.7

Force = 13,106.5N

The centripetal force = 13,106.5N

= 1.31 × 10⁴N
